Output 6cae50af478dd11bbcbc2b7e568e88a403afeee692e71f40bdd6b8d3ff7ef724:2

value
36453124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5020c39e71035757e50bdee9c0eafbc8889c87aa OP_EQUAL
address
38zhEP8HUENXVdDWoDiXbHD8cthWze6Rp5
transaction
6cae50af478dd11bbcbc2b7e568e88a403afeee692e71f40bdd6b8d3ff7ef724
confirmations
339007
spent
true